 there might be a way to make wings work. Only lift a part of the wing and lift it at an angle.
Then when that part of the wing is pushed down, it would have air underneath it which could flow outward under the wing creating more lift.
 This would allow for the possibility of using leverage to get more work out of a downward stroke.
If you watch birds fly, they don't lift the tips of their wings, probably saves a lot of energy that way.
 I think that's how the Wright Brothers got their plane to fly. They saw how a bird's wings worked and allowed for the wings on their airplane to twist. Before that, all wings were made of a rigid design.
 Today, they are now called wing flaps and ailerons.

Ornithopters On August 2, 2010, Todd Reichert of the University of Toronto Institute for Aerospace Studies piloted a human-powered ornithopter named Snowbird. The 32 metres (105 ft 0 in) wingspan 42 kilograms (93 lb) aircraft was constructed from carbon fibre, balsa, and foam. The pilot sat in a small cockpit suspended below the wings and pumped a bar with his feet to operate a system of wires that flapped the wings up and down. Towed by a car until airborne, it then sustained flight for almost 20 seconds. It flew 145 meters with an average speed of 25.6 km/h (7.1 m/s) [21] Similar tow-launched flights were made in the past, but improved data collection verified that the ornithopter was capable of self-powered flight once aloft.[22][23][24]

I don’t know about buying it but why not building it?! It’s very simple yet quite clever.
 
Here is my version about how it works:
Setup: non-magnetic big wheel, ferromagnetic ball.
Blue-red handheld “magnet” is actually a permanent magnet and a coil powered by a small oscillator or on-off switch (probably at several hundred hertz) plus a battery (of course), all concealed inside.
Initially, considering the coil not powered, the permanent magnet holds the ball in place, in equilibrium on the rim of the big wheel. There are no forces to create angular momentum thus no rotation. :(
 
However, by powering the small coil so as it works additive to the existing magnetic field of the permanent magnet, the coil will now attract the ball to a slightly higher equilibrium point. The ball will always get there by spinning because that’s the least energy-consuming movement (it’s pretty much similar to why a ball will spin on the floor when thrown away, instead of translating on the floor; simple stuff – hope you’ve got it).
When ball spins and rises toward the new equilibrium point, the big wheel spins too, due to friction. Interesting enough, both ball and wheel spin in the same direction. That’s a slight issue since in order the whole motor/setup to run as presented, when coil is shut of, the ball has to at least slightly slide downwards against the now turning wheel or otherwise the big wheel would not rotate as seen. It’s because of angular momentum conservation but I suppose the readers already understand it or they don’t care much.
 
Nevertheless, the setup although inefficient as a motor is pretty clever, very fun and easy to build!
